Olivia Cooke - photo #527

Olivia Cooke, photo #1266128
Olivia Cooke pic #1266127 1920x800
Olivia Cooke pic #1266128 1920x800
Olivia Cooke pic #1266129 1920x800

Olivia Cooke photo #1266128 (527 of 803)
Added: 2021-09-03 00:00:00
Size: 1920x800 px (0 Kb)

More Olivia Cooke photos

Olivia Cooke pic #1280454 3000x1987
Olivia Cooke pic #1309643 1366x2048 1
Olivia Cooke pic #1257921 1920x1036 1
Olivia Cooke pic #1249876 1920x1080